The secret to an easy bento box school lunch is following the rule of threes. Start with a main dish, then add a fruit and/or vegetable, and finish with a side or small treat. Since bento boxes are already divided into sections, packing a balanced school lunch couldn’t be easier. Simply choose one item from each category, arrange everything in your bento box, and lunch is ready to go! Main Dish Ideas

If you’re looking to switch things up from the traditional turkey sandwich, here are a few of my favorite main dish ideas to add to your bento boxes!

  • Mini Sandwiches
  • Grilled Chicken or Beef Skewers: I recommend removing the protein from the skewer for the sake of school safety. 
  • Turkey Tortilla Pinwheels
  • Turkey Muffins: Try out my tried and true recipe
  • Quesadillas
  • Clean Ramen Noodles
  • Crockpot Chicken: This is a great way to utilize leftovers!
  • Avocado Toast
  • Egg Muffins
  • Mini Bagels: Either keep the toppings simple with cream cheese or create a bagel sandwich!
  • Mini Quiches
  • Hard-Boiled Eggs
